Transaction 24cc79462a764dbe3893066cac5ca8b91920690524a05cd057b707ebebad336b
1 Input
1 Output
-
24cc79462a764dbe3893066cac5ca8b91920690524a05cd057b707ebebad336b:0
- value
- 32193135
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 14037b83595d1fefab0d90d92f38dc4a51c5664b OP_EQUAL
- address
- 33WqcM4yhcj4wyMpVZmVSa23j5tiXG7AeC